This is a prospective, multicenter, single-arm registry study, aimed to evaluate the clinical outcomes of using Shockwave IVL catheter in the treatment of coronary artery calcification in real-world clinical practice.

主要结局
Procedure success
时间窗: in 48 hours post-procedure or prior to discharge, whichever comes first
Procedure success defined as successful stent implantation, residual stenosis degree \<30% (core laboratory), and no major adverse cardiac events (MACE) occurring during hospitalization
Freedom from major adverse cardiac events (MACE) within 30 days of the index procedure
时间窗: 30 days post index procedure
MACE is defined as: Cardiac death; or Myocardial Infarction (MI): Follow the Fourth Universal Definition of Myocardial Infarction ; or Target Vessel Revascularization (TVR) defined as revascularization at the target vessel (inclusive of the target lesion) after the completion of the index procedure; or Target lesion thrombosis.
